--- Comment #2 from John Louis <[email protected]> ---
I completed the requested testing.

1. Skia software rendering

I enabled "Force Skia software rendering" (LibreOffice → Settings → LibreOffice
→ View), restarted LibreOffice, and verified in Help → About that the UI
renderer changed to:

UI render: Skia/Raster
VCL: osx

With Skia/Raster, the resize jitter disappears completely. Window resizing is
smooth and I can no longer reproduce the issue.

After unchecking "Force Skia software rendering" and restarting LibreOffice,
the renderer returned to Skia/Metal and the resize jitter consistently
reappeared.

The testing was performed on the MacBook Pro's built-in display only (no
external monitor or dock connected).

2. GPU information

Graphics/Displays:

Apple M1 Pro:
  Chipset Model: Apple M1 Pro
  Type: GPU
  Bus: Built-In
  Total Number of Cores: 16
  Vendor: Apple (0x106b)
  Metal Support: Metal 4

Current environment:

LibreOffice 26.2.4.2 (AARCH64)
macOS 26.5.2

Based on these tests, the issue is reproducible with Skia/Metal on my system,
while enabling Skia software rendering (Skia/Raster) serves as a workaround.
